Implementation of Function-Focused Care in the Hospital Setting: Results of the FFC-AC-EIT Trial

Abstract
Once hospitalized, individuals living with dementia are more likely to experience negative impacts of hospitalization including a decline in physical activity, function, falls, delirium, and behavioral symptoms associated with dementia, when compared to individuals without cognitive impairment. The Function Focused Care for Acute Care Using the Evidence Integration Triangle (FFC-AC-EIT) intervention, in contrast to structured exercise or mobility programs, helps nurses engage patients in routine care activities and therefore provides a more realistic and sustainable approach to increase function and physical activity.
